MAGRITTE RENÉ: (1898-1967) Belgian Surrealist Artist. His work has influenced Pop Art and Minimalist Art. An excellent A.L.S., `René Magritte´, one page, 8vo, 97 Rue des Mimosas, Brussels, 1st of May 1959, to Remy, in French. Magritte thanks his correspondent for his letter and states in part `Thank you for your offer to exhibit one of my past paintings. It will be if you do not mind for a future occasion, as the today´s date exhibition in the Ixelles Museum only shows paintings from 1926..´ further saying `If I walk by La Panne any day in future, I´ll look for you to say hello and with pleasure will look again at this painting which I do not keep any remembrance.´ Accompanied by the letter Magritte received from his correspondent, T.L.S., `Remy´, one page, 4to, Brussels, 23rd April [1959], to René Magritte, in French.
